During the second half of 2011 – also as an e-book. “Solaris” soon will be available as an Audible audio-book. ![]() The new meticulous translation is the work of Bill Johnston, a professor of Comparative Literature at Indiana University. Then the French text served as a basis for the English edition. Previous translation was remotely related to the children's "broken telephone game" initially the book was translated from Polish into French. ![]()
